Abstract

The utility model discloses a kind of measure apparatus of youngs modulus, including base, column is mounted at left and right sides of the top of the base, the top of the column is provided with crossbeam, platform is installed, the bottom corner of the base is mounted on the first pole, and the bottom of first pole is provided with the second pole at the outer wall center of the column, spring is installed, the inner side upper and lower ends of the spring are mounted on fix bar on the inside of second pole.The measure apparatus of youngs modulus, when using analyzer, the gravity of taper plummet in itself pulls base slightly to sink, and the second pole is extruded spring, and spring shrinks when being extruded by certain power, rebounded during less than certain force, make the height of base bottom corner adjusted, so that base maintains horizontality, without regulation manually, it is easy to user to use, while improves the accuracy of measurement data.

Background technology
At present, the Young's modulus of generally use pulling method measuring steel wire, in experiment by increase hang equal quality counterweight come The elongation to steel wire is realized, miniature deformation amount corresponding to steel wire is measured with light lever principle.Existing measure apparatus of youngs modulus makes In, its structure is roughly the same, is made up of base, middle cross beam, entablature, fixed pillar, counterweight, steel wire and set lever. Test during steel wire stretching effect, it is necessary in the wire lower end of stretched vertically installation sinking counterweight, sinking weight is installed herein Code structure is the T-shape turned around a shape, and the sagging one end of steel wire is connected with T-shaped vertical section, and counterweight is arranged on T-shaped plane of structure On, such as the patent of Application No. 201620252646.3, including base, fixed pillar, on base, middle cross beam, lead to Cross set lever to be arranged in the middle part of fixed pillar, entablature is arranged on fixed pillar upper end, and steel wire one end is consolidated by locking device It is scheduled on entablature, for the other end through hanging down naturally after the threaded hole of steel of middle cross beam, positioning sleeve passes through the positioning that is arranged on base Hole is arranged on base, and locating slide rod one end is provided with centre bore, during by locking mechanism, the free one end of steel wire is fixed on In heart hole, although improving security, its base in measurement is not easy regulation and arrives horizontality, easily causes observation number According to error, make measurement data not accurate enough.

Compared with prior art, the beneficial effects of the utility model are:The measure apparatus of youngs modulus, when using analyzer When, the gravity of taper plummet in itself pulls base slightly to sink, and base drives the movement of the first pole, and the first pole drives second Bar is moved, and the second pole is extruded spring, and spring shrinks when being extruded by certain power, is rebounded during less than certain force, is made base The height of bottom corner is adjusted, so that base maintains horizontality, without regulation manually, is easy to user to use, The accuracy of measurement data is improved simultaneously.

Fig. 1-4 are referred to, the utility model provides a kind of technical scheme:A kind of measure apparatus of youngs modulus, including base 1, Base 1 is used for support post 2, is mounted on column 2 at left and right sides of the top of base 1, column 2 is used for support beam 3, column 2 Top crossbeam 3 is installed, crossbeam 3 is used to support the fixed article for needing to measure, and platform is provided with the outer wall center of column 2 4, the bottom of platform 4 is provided with pull bar 5, and pull bar 5 is used to support supporting plate 6, is connected with the article that need to be measured, the outer wall of pull bar 5 is set There is frosting 24, frosting 24 has the function that to increase friction effect, for the frictional force between increase and counterweight, places counterweight Easily come off, the outer wall bottom of pull bar 5 is provided with supporting plate 6, and supporting plate 6, which is used to support, places counterweight, and the top of supporting plate 6, which is provided with, rubs Rib 23 is wiped, friction rib 23 can increase the frictional force between counterweight, and the bottom of supporting plate 6 is provided with fixture block 22, and fixture block 22 is used for Connection between reinforced pallet 6 and pull bar 5, fixture block 22 are connected with pull bar 5, and fixture block 22 is fixed on the bottom of pull bar 5, base 1 Bottom corner is mounted on the first pole 10, and the first pole 10 is used for support base 1, and the bottom of the first pole 10 is provided with two Second pole 9, the second pole 9 are used to support the first pole 10, and the inner side of two the second poles 9 is provided with spring 16, spring 16 For compression spring, coefficient of elasticity 5N/CM, the inner side upper and lower ends of spring 16 are mounted on fix bar 15, and fix bar 15 is used for Fixed spring 16 is supported, when preventing that spring 16 is squeezed, is shifted, fix bar 15 is connected with the second pole 9, fix bar 15 It is fixed on the second pole 9, the bottom of the second pole 9 of lower section is provided with support plate 8, and support plate 8 is used to support the second pole 9, branch The bottom of plate 8 is provided with rubber blanket 25, and rubber blanket 25 is made for quality of rubber materials, can increasing friction force, the bottom of base 1 3rd pole 14 is installed, the 3rd pole 14 is used for supporting linkage 11, and the inner side of the 3rd pole 14 is provided with connection at center Bar 11, connecting rod 11 are used to support connection taper plummet 7, and the left and right sides of connecting rod 11 is mounted on bull stick 12, connecting rod 11 It can be rotated around bull stick 12, bull stick 12 is connected by bearing 13 with the 3rd pole 14, and bearing 13 is ball bearing, connecting rod 11 Bottom taper plummet 7 is installed, the moment of taper plummet 7 is all freely sagging, for ensureing that base 1 remains horizontal flat Line position is put, and the front side of the first pole 10 is provided with horizontal line 18, and when horizontal line 18 overlaps with horizon rule 17, front base 1 is horizontal Position, the outside of horizontal line 18 are provided with the 4th pole 19, and the 4th pole 19 is used to support draw ring 20, the 4th pole 19 and first Pole 10 is connected, and the 4th pole 19 is fixed on the first pole 10, and the outer wall of the 4th pole 19 is socketed with draw ring 20, draw ring 20 with 4th pole 19, which coordinates, to be connected, and draw ring 20 can rotate in the outside of the 4th pole 19, and the bottom of draw ring 20 is provided with horizon rule 17, the bottom of horizon rule 17 is provided with shot 21, and shot 21 is by cord with being connected at the center of the bottom of horizon rule 17.
When using analyzer, the gravity of taper plummet 7 itself pulls base 1 slightly to sink, and base 1 drives first Bar 10 moves, and the first pole 10 drives the second pole 9 to move, and the second pole 9 is extruded spring 16, and spring 16 is by certain power Shunk during extruding, rebound during less than certain force, make the height of the bottom corner of base 1 adjusted, observation horizon rule 17 with it is horizontal Whether line 18 is parallel, and then determines the state of base 1, then observes measurement data.
